T-cell homing receptor expression in IgA nephropathy
Arvind Batra1, Alice C Smith, John Feehally
1Department of Infection, Immunity and Inflammation, University of Leicester, and John Walls Renal Unit, Leicester General Hospital, Leicester LE5 4PW, UK.
In IgA nephropathy (IgAN), activated CD4 T cells show altered homing receptors, directing them to systemic sites. This suggests these cells may drive the increased polymeric IgA production characteristic of IgAN.

Background:
- IgA nephropathy (IgAN) involves polymeric IgA (pIgA) deposition in the kidneys.
- IgAN shows reduced mucosal and increased systemic pIgA production.
- Lymphocyte homing receptors (HR) guide cells to specific tissues.
Purpose of the Study:
- Investigate T-cell subset HR expression in IgAN.
- Compare IgAN patients with healthy adults and membranous nephropathy (MN) patients.
- Identify potential mechanisms for aberrant pIgA production in IgAN.
Main Methods:
- Analyzed peripheral blood T cells (CD3, CD4, CD8) using flow cytometry.
- Assessed expression of L-selectin, integrin alpha4beta1, and integrin alpha4beta7.
- Evaluated HR expression patterns in IgAN, healthy adults, and MN patients.
Main Results:
- IgAN T cells exhibited reduced L-selectin and increased alpha4beta1 expression.
- No differences in alpha4beta7 expression were observed.
- Abnormalities were confined to the CD4 T-cell subset; CD8 T cells were normal.
- No HR expression abnormalities were found in MN patients.
Conclusions:
- Reduced L-selectin and increased alpha4beta1 on CD4 T cells indicate activation in IgAN.
- These activated CD4 T cells preferentially home to systemic sites.
- Hypothesize that these systemic-homing CD4 T cells contribute to aberrant systemic pIgA production in IgAN.
